Less than 12 hours/week total or just for biking? Guessing total?

For the full distance, I would think about maybe even doing less frequency but longer duration. Something like 4 rides broken up as 2x sweet spot days (1 day slightly shorter reps than the other day, 90% FTP), 1x tempo/longer distance rep days (10:00-30:00 reps @ 70-85% FTP), and 1 long ride day. 1.5-2 hours for the 1st 3 days. 3ish hours, building up from there for the long ride days.
